1909 European Figure Skating Championships
The 1909 European Figure Skating Championships were held from January 23 to January 24 in Budapest, Hungary. Budapest was part of the Austrian Empire at this time. Elite figure skaters competed for the title of European Champion in the category of men's singles.[1]

Results
Men
Rank | Name | Nation | Fact. Places |
---|---|---|---|
1 | Ulrich Salchow | ![]() | 9 |
2 | Gilbert Fuchs | ![]() | 15 |
3 | Per Thorén | ![]() | 18 |
4 | Karl Ollo | ![]() | 31 |
5 | Sándor Urbáry | ![]() | 32 |
